Description On 15th November, 2016, Clara Amalia, the wife of James, Prince of Wales, died peacefully at Birkhall , the official residence for the couple, at the age of 67. She had been ill for quite some time. The official cause of death was a stroke, with Left-Side Heart Failure being a contributing factor. Her family were by her side, James being reportedly devastated by the loss, as they had been married for fifty-one years by that point. The news of her passing was made public minutes later, with outpouring of grief being noticeable across the kingdom.

On November 18th, the casket bearing the remains of Clara was taken to Westminster Hall to lay in state. During the laying in state, an estimated 1 million people filed past the casket, all paying their respect to the most beloved Princess since Diana. A couple of days later, the casket was taken to St. George's Chapel, with a family service was held. James, in a wheelchair due to a fall weeks prior, gently patted the casket, and gave it a simple kiss, a moving act of love. Then, with all watching, the casket was lowered to the temporary vault. James would follow Clara in death ten years later.
